Farmers Company was founded in the great state of California back in 1928 by Thomas E. Leavey and John C. Tyler. In the 1980's it became a part of the Zurich Financial Services Group. In 2000 the Farmers Insurance Group of Companies merged with Foremost Corporation and expanded its insurance products even more into manufactured homes and recreational vehicles and water vehicles. Farmers Insurance has historically reached out to help its customers. In California it has set up facilities to aid victims of the wildfires - writing checks for customers needs during the crisis (like lodging and meals). When Hurricane Rita struck the Gulf Coast of Texas, the company not only helped settle claims with excellent service, but also donated generators to help city governments.
